Erwin Budi Setiawan is a scholar working on Information Systems, Artificial Intelligence and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Erwin Budi Setiawan has authored 149 papers receiving a total of 606 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 85 papers in Information Systems, 80 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 16 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Erwin Budi Setiawan's work include Data Mining and Machine Learning Applications (41 papers), Information Retrieval and Data Mining (39 papers) and Sentiment Analysis and Opinion Mining (38 papers). Erwin Budi Setiawan is often cited by papers focused on Data Mining and Machine Learning Applications (41 papers), Information Retrieval and Data Mining (39 papers) and Sentiment Analysis and Opinion Mining (38 papers). Erwin Budi Setiawan collaborates with scholars based in Indonesia and United Kingdom. Erwin Budi Setiawan's co-authors include Dwi H. Widyantoro, Kridanto Surendro, Z. K. A. Baizal, Isman Kurniawan, A. Adam, Kemas Muslim Lhaksmana, Siti Halimah Larekeng, Didit Adytia, Suksmandhira Harimurti and Steven Steven and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of Physics Conference Series and TELKOMNIKA (Telecommunication Computing Electronics and Control).
